>> >>> Yazdy ji
>> >>> I don't think S. viarum which has young fruit with white patches and
>> >>> pale
>> >>> yellow mature fruit.
>> >>> May be it is S. capsicoides because of unequal pairs of leaves,
>> >>> straight
>> >>> needle-like prickles and more importantly orange coloured mature
>> >>> fruits and
>> >>> green glabrous young fruits.
